New clause XXVIIIA deals with dissolution. Mr O'Grady's

draft included the main provision of paragraph (1) of this

clause, but the proviso does of course follow. If we adopt

alternative two for clause XIIA then the paragraph (2) in

square brackets is necessary in this clause. Paragraph (3)

deals with the problem of an emergency sitting between a

dissolution and an election. Mr O'Grady accepted that such a provision was a necessary "fail safe" solution.

7. I think it would be desirable to send the draft, together

with the explanation in paragraphs 3 to 6 above to Hong Kong tonight. Mr O'Grady will then be in a position to obtain

instructions in order to have a discussion with me tomorrow

morning.

8.

I attach, marked Flag B, Mr O'Grady's drafts.
